Rigetti Computing, a company focused on developing and commercializing quantum computing technology, has recently achieved significant milestones that have piqued investor interest. The company's stock has surged following announcements of technological advancements and government contracts, signaling a promising future in the quantum computing field.

Rigetti Computing's latest breakthrough, achieving 99.5% median 2-qubit gate fidelity on its new 36-qubit system, has been hailed as a substantial step forward in the quest for fault-tolerant quantum computing [1]. This technological achievement is crucial because it indicates more accurate quantum operations, which are essential for the advancement of the field. Rigetti's CEO, Subodh Kulkarni, highlighted their commitment to utilizing superconducting qubits, which provide gate speeds over a thousand times faster than alternative technologies such as ion traps and pure atoms, significantly enhancing scalability for higher qubit count systems [2].

The company's financial performance also offers some insights into its potential. Rigetti Computing completed a $350 million equity offering in June, bringing total cash to approximately $575 million with zero debt. This substantial financial backing provides a strong foundation for the company's operations and research [1]. However, investors should be aware of the risks, as Rigetti Computing currently depicts high volatility, with a substantial 52-week price range from a low of $0.66 to a high of $21.42 [2].

Moreover, Rigetti Computing's strategic partnerships have further validated its approach. The company has secured several research contracts from the Department of Defense and the U.K. government, and has partnered with Nvidia and Quanta Computer, indicating confidence in its technology [1]. However, the company's financial and operational challenges remain significant, with profitability being a key concern [2].

In the broader context of the quantum computing industry, Rigetti Computing faces stiff competition from other companies such as IonQ, IBM, and Alphabet. The potential applications of quantum computing are vast, ranging from drug discovery to cryptography, and could be worth trillions. However, the path to quantum advantage remains challenging, and the industry is still in its early stages [1].

For investors willing to accept substantial risk, Rigetti Computing offers exposure to quantum computing's tremendous upside potential. The company has solid technology, adequate funding, and credible partnerships. However, in a field where competition is fierce, picking winners remains a speculative exercise.
